What can a clever detective, a golden statue, and a selfish giant teach students about greed, generosity, and honesty? This webinar shows how classic English stories—Silver Blaze, The Happy Prince, and The Selfish Giant—can make A1/A2 learners’ English fun, interactive, and meaningful. Participants will discover dynamic activity ideas to introduce the stories, explore key themes, and engage students in creative, active post-reading projects, while reinforcing vocabulary and grammar. Digital resources will also be provided, giving teachers ready-to-use ideas to make literature exciting and accessible in the classroom.
Durante il webinar verranno affrontati i seguenti temi:
- Creative ways to spark curiosity and engage learners before reading.
- Activities to examine greed, generosity, and honesty while practicing vocabulary, grammar, and speaking.
- Role-play, story extensions, and interactive activities to deepen understanding.
- Practical tools and ready-to-use materials to support teachers and enhance student learning.
